What is PPC?
Pay-Per-Click (PPC) is a type of online advertising where you only pay when someone clicks on your ad. These ads appear on search engines like Google, usually at the top of the search results.
Imagine you manage properties in Sarasota, and someone searches for “luxury apartments Sarasota.” If you have a PPC ad that relates to that search, your ad can appear right at the top, making it immediately visible to potential customers.
The key takeaway? PPC is a way to advertise your business to local customers who are already looking for your services, ensuring you reach your target audience directly.

1. Instant Visibility
When you set up a PPC campaign, your ads can start appearing immediately. Unlike other marketing methods like SEO (Search Engine Optimization), which can take months to show results, PPC puts you on the map right away. For property managers eager to fill vacancies or attract new clients, this immediate visibility is crucial.
Example: If someone types in “find a property manager in Sarasota” and your ad pops up at the top, chances are they will click on it. Your business will be the first they see.
2. Targeted Advertising
PPC allows you to be very specific about who sees your ads. You can target based on location, interests, and even time of day. For example, if you manage vacation rentals, you can target people interested in travel or families looking for summer getaways.
By pinpointing your audience, you can maximize your budget and ensure that the right people see your ads at the right time.
Example: A local property management company can run ads targeting people searching for “family-friendly rentals in Sarasota,” ensuring they attract their ideal tenants.
3. Cost-Effective Marketing
PPC is budget-friendly because you set your own budget and only pay when someone clicks on your ad. This model allows small businesses to manage their spending effectively and gives you control over your advertising costs.
Moreover, you can set daily, weekly, or monthly budgets to assist in managing expenses better.
Example: If you set a daily budget of $20, you know you won’t overspend, and you can change your budget as you see what works best for your business.
4. Measurable Results
PPC offers detailed analytics that shows how your ads are performing. You can see how many people clicked on your ad, the number of calls you received, and even how many bookings were made. This data is invaluable because it helps you understand what is and isn’t working.
Using these insights, you can refine your approach, making adjustments over time for better performance.
Example: If you notice that ads promoting beach-front properties lead to more calls than ads for city apartments, you can focus on promoting the beach properties more heavily.
5. Increased Revenue
Ultimately, the goal of any marketing strategy is to increase profits. With proper PPC management, you can drive more traffic to your website and generate more inquiries, leading to higher occupancy rates for your properties.
Example: If your ad leads to just one new lease per month, that could translate into hundreds or thousands in rental income, showcasing how PPC can significantly contribute to your bottom line.

FAQs
1. What is the difference between PPC and SEO?
PPC (Pay-Per-Click) is a paid form of advertising that allows you to immediately place your ads at the top of search engines. SEO (Search Engine Optimization) is a long-term strategy that aims to improve your website’s organic ranking over time without paying for clicks.
2. How much should I budget for PPC?
Budge wisely! It depends on your industry and goals. A good starting point is to invest at least $500 a month. Monitor your results and adjust as needed.
3. How quickly will I see results from PPC?
PPC can start generating results almost immediately after your ads are live. However, refining your campaign for maximum effectiveness may take a few weeks.
4. Can I manage PPC myself, or should I hire a professional?
While small businesses can manage their PPC campaigns, the expertise of a professional can help maximize your results and save time.
5. What types of businesses benefit from PPC?
Any business that needs more visibility can benefit from PPC, especially local service providers like property managers, restaurants, and retail shops.
